Jimmy Kimmel Marks Guillermo’s 55th Birthday With Childhood Photos

Jimmy Kimmel on Tuesday night did right by his right-hand man.

As Guillermo Rodriguez turned 55, Jimmy Kimmel Live!—as the ABC talker has done for some of the security guard-turned-sidekick’s previous birthdays—clued viewers into the occasion.

“I’m going to tell you something, you’re you’re here on a very special night. A night of celebration not only here, but all around the world,” Kimmel opened his monologue. “Fifty-five years ago today, on January 27th, 1971, Don Julio and the Pillsbury Doughboy welcomed a child together, a baby. And they named him Guillermo.

“And tonight, we wish him a happy birthday,” Kimmel added, sparking much audience applause.

“Did you know you serve a birthday with Mozart?” asked Kimmel, turning to his sidekick; Guillermo shook his head. “And Edward Smith, the captain of the Titanic, He went down with the ship. Would you go down with the ship?”

Guillermo thought for a second, then shrugged, “Maybe, maybe.”

Kimmel shared with viewers several childhood photos of Guillermo, from “before he met tequila.” The trip down memory lane included a Little League snapshot; one of a teenage Guillermo in costume as a woman; and one of his budding mustache circa age 14.

“And as of this week, he is a full-fledged salsa magnate!” said Kimmel of Rodriguez’s recent Costco launch.

Kimmel then invited the guest of honor to “feel free to barely pay attention for the rest of the show.”

Earlier on Tuesday, Kimmel commemorated the big day by posting to Instagram a photo from Guillermo’s aforementioned salsa brand launch, with the message: “A very happy double cinco to my old pal and new salsa magnate Guillermo—available at Costco in the northeast US and nationwide SOON.” The official show account in turn shared a montage of Guillermo photos, captioned, “Happy 55th Birthday to our beloved Guillermo! We love you so much G!”
